Originally released in 1976 on the notoriously obscure TSG Records imprint, the New Jersey group's sole album disappeared almost immediately, yet gradually became a treasured discovery among rare-soul collectors, DJs and deep-funk enthusiasts. TSG was one of several American so-called tax-scam labels whose releases were often produced in tiny quantities with minimal promotion or distribution. Commercial success was rarely the point, and many artists received little recognition for the work they had made. As a result, original copies of \u003cem\u003e1619 Bad Ass Band\u003c\/em\u003e became extremely difficult to find, eventually earning holy-grail status on the collector market.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eMusically, the album is far more than a curiosity. Led by Khalid Abdul Shalid, the group move confidently between gritty funk, modern soul and richly arranged balladry. The drum-heavy drive of “Love To Love” captures the band's raw live energy, while “Rain” reveals a softer, dreamier side. “Just From You” glides on elegant strings, and the spacey synthesiser lines of “Nothing Can Stop My Loving You” make it a standout for modern-soul listeners. “Step Out” opens with a powerful break later sampled by Latyrx, before unfolding into an inspired male-female vocal exchange.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eOriginally reissued in 1978 with alternate artwork on Graham International, the record remained scarce in every form.
